That is a decent discount given that the price support and finance contributions all changed as of 1st April for the new quarter.

The BMW finance contribution has been removed and the BMW UK/Dealer discounts increased (not fully compensating though) as far as I am aware. The discounts from Coast2coast etc are for cash or finance now.

I ordered mine in March and managed to get my local dealer to within a few hundred quid of Coast2coast. Close enough for it to be worth the extra to not have to travel to collect and build a relationship locally if I have any issues. However, with the price support changes I am now about £500 up compared to current broker prices so happy to have signed in March!

As you say elsewhere, that's excluding finance. So, add in the deposit contribution of (currently) £2,250, and that's a great deal. My discount was slightly higher, but not much.

Now, you may be a cash buyer, but suggest you do a small amount of car on HP, keep it on HP a few months, then pay it off. the interest you will pay in those few months will be far less than the £2250 you get by taking the finance. That's what i'm doing.
